LATROBE, PA — Timken Latrobe Steel, a subsidiary of The Timken Co., has increased prices by 6 to 8 percent on rounds, plate and flats tool steel and alloy products. Raw material surcharges will remain in effect.
David Murray, vice president – sales and marketing – Timken Latrobe Steel, said in a written statement that high energy, scrap and production costs are reasons for this price increase.
Timken Latrobe Steel is a leading specialty steel producer in North America. For more information, go to: www.timken.com.
